Transaction 2a66d714ac6479a226ed49ae60d0503b704c6305cdd27e310862e4e8c00ece62

1 Input
2 Outputs
  • 2a66d714ac6479a226ed49ae60d0503b704c6305cdd27e310862e4e8c00ece62:0
  • value  690000
    address  163UazWZDF7GHcbggfxFAc3RG24PREmzyw
  • 2a66d714ac6479a226ed49ae60d0503b704c6305cdd27e310862e4e8c00ece62:1
  • value  102007752
    address  37X5mtn38nHj9ZtDeyZKfvwWjjuguNdvgK